# Break-Glass: Catalog Cache Invalidation

Scope: the Pinrow product catalog at Veldstone Retail. If stale prices persist after a purge and the Hollowmere invalidation queue is wedged, use break-glass to flush the edge tier directly. Contractors: get verbal sign-off from the catalog lead first. Steps: open the Hollowmere admin shell, select emergency-flush, confirm the tenant, and run it once — repeated flushes thrash the origin. Access is logged and expires after 20 minutes. Unseal the admin shell with the passphrase below.

recovery phrase for kahop-tajog: istix-casvan

## Changelog — Tidemark Widget 3.2

Defaults changed. Read before touching anything.

- Refresh interval now hourly, not every 15 min. Harbor feeds from the Pellisport aggregator throttle aggressive polling.
- Lunar-offset correction is on by default. Disable only for legacy Kestrel Bay deployments.
- Chart units default to metric. The imperial fallback flag is deprecated and will be removed in 3.4.
- Cache eviction is now time-based, not size-based.

New installs should start from the default configuration values listed below.

config for kahap-taweg:
oliox:
  pin: 8609
  tenant: casath
  seal: seal_632a4a6f
  metrics_host: metrics.oliox.nelvrogrid.example
  standby_team: keleth
  escalation: briiel-oliwyn
  nonce: e2397c

## Releases

Sweepwright, the orphaned-resource sweeper, is released monthly. Each release bundles the detection rules for dangling volumes, unattached addresses, and stale snapshots across the Calloway regions. Tag the release, run the dry-run suite against the replay fixtures, and confirm zero false-positive deletions before promoting. The scheduler nodes will only load rule bundles that carry a valid signature; unsigned bundles are silently skipped, which looks like a no-op sweep. Sign every bundle with the deploy key below.

rollout seal: bky4_x7Gc